"Good tests but I disagree with the conclusions.

After the bow was fired at the enemies on the side of the screen they started moving, but they were not "Aggro'd". They were just doing a basic AI movement to get out of harms way, which is why most of the time they walked away from the user. The gargantuan beast just happened to eventually stroll close enough toward the player to "see" him and be properly aggro'd.

I do not think Blizz has done any work to change the aggro range, and still think it's a problem for PvM balance, let alone PvP balance.

It is interesting to show you can just manually adjust your resolution to whatever ratio in Nvidia control panel. With that in mind, whats stopping us from loading some insane ratios like 90:1 and teleporting a whole area in 1 tele, or casting blizzard from 10x screens away?

Hint: nothing stops you and its totally game breaking."
